Love Notes Of Hope


A Better Way Ministry Inc. invites United Way Day of Caring volunteers to help us create something simple, personal, and powerful: Love Notes of encouragement for domestic violence survivors and the dedicated shelter workers who serve them.


Volunteers will spend time writing heartfelt messages to survivors—reminding them that they are seen, valued, supported, and not forgotten. Volunteers will also write notes of appreciation to shelter workers, recognizing the compassion, strength, and commitment they bring to this difficult work every day.


 


No special skills or experience are needed. We simply ask volunteers to bring an open heart and a willingness to encourage someone they may never meet.


 


The Love Notes will later be shared with survivors and shelter workers throughout Northwest Indiana as part of A Better Way Ministry Inc.’s community outreach.
